Wandsworth Common station prides itself on being user-friendly with a plethora of facilities. The ticket office operates from early mornings to nearly midnight, offering flexibility for your travel plans. If buying tickets in advance suits you better, pick them up at the available ticket machines. Accessibility is a thoughtful addition here, with induction loops and Disabled Persons Railcard-enabled ticket machines ensuring ease for everyone.
While the station doesn’t have waiting rooms, you can find seating areas to relax before catching your train. Safety is prioritized through the presence of CCTV, and while luggage storage is unavailable, the staff offers assistance for those who need help navigating the station. The charming simplicity of Wandsworth is slightly amplified by a free 24-hour parking service managed by APCOA Parking UK, with space for 25 vehicles, including one accessible spot.

For the cycle enthusiasts, the station offers 66 bicycle storage spaces, sheltered and monitored by CCTV. While there's no cycle hire available on-site, it's easy to meander through the picturesque streets of Wandsworth by renting a bike nearby.

Though small, Alvechurch Train Station is designed to cater to essential travel needs. While there isn't a conventional ticket office, commuters can easily collect tickets from the available ticket machines on-site. Unfortunately, these machines are not accessible for those with disabilities, but an induction loop system is available for the hearing impaired. If you need any information or assistance, help is readily available through a help point on the platform.
The station boasts step-free access, ensuring mobility for passengers with restricted movement. However, certain facilities are lacking, including accessible toilets, waiting rooms, and refreshments. Still, you’ll find a seating area on-site for a brief respite. It's worth noting that there is no designated parking area for individuals with special needs, though general parking space is available free of charge.
If you’re pondering how to reach your final destination upon arriving at Alvechurch, fret not. The station is well linked with local bus routes and rail replacement services. For travellers needing to move towards Birmingham, buses operate from the stop outside The Red Lion pub. Alternatively, for trips to Redditch, head to the nearby public service bus stop on Red Lion Street.
